Перейти к содержанию
AUTO-BK.RU FORUM

виктор44

Master
  • Постов

    334
  • Зарегистрирован

  • Посещение

  • Победитель дней

    1

Весь контент виктор44

  1. Исправил обороты ХХ для Январей ,проверяйте. Исходники.zip
  2. Если приедет к тебе эта интересная Калина сними с неё логи по вентиляторам.Я посмотрю что она отвечает.
  3. ААААА,понятно,а то я расшифровал ДТ как диагностический тестер.
  4. Что за разъём можно подробней?Насчёт регулировки оборотов ХХ: я понял что для Январей надо писать по другому.У них ответ по протоколу,а для М73 и возможно для М74 те кто писал к ним ПО упростили ответ.У меня М73,по его ответу я и писал.
  5. sashashemelev посмотри в личке.
  6. Мы не знаем кто как будет использовать.Памяти освободится немного.Свободной практически нет(около 1 КБ).Вердикт:ПУСТЬ БУДЕТ, Кстати моя прибамбасина нормально показывает обороты в ИМ,а написано одинаково)))
  7. Ага.Жду.Просто у меня нет шнурка,да он мне и не нужен пока.
  8. Попробуй регулировку оборотов ХХ на М73 или М74.Похоже Январи и эти блоки выдают разные ответы.Если есть возможность,то сними логи программой OpenDiag с регулировкой оборотов ХХ Я7.2 и М73 и вышли мне.Выкладываю прошивку и схему(немного подправил).Попробуй не правя tytle.c,я там заменил 0х07 на 0х0F букву П.Регулировка яркости и времени ожидания ответа в главном меню. ИСХОДНИКИ.RAR
  9. Сам об этом подумал.Будет управление подсветкой и временем ожидания ответа из главного меню.
  10. А чем её читать?Может сделать в формате который доступен всем?
  11. ravext привет. В меге 168 эмулятор ответов ЭБУ для отладки в протеусе.
  12. sashashemelev скинь мне пожалуйста схему которую делал последнюю.
  13. Да,что-то я слегка перемудрил! Исправил управление ИМ,чтение общих ошибок.Доп.параметры Я7.2 должен читать(может они не во всех блоках)?По крайней мере запрос идёт правильный.В Меню ПОДСВЕТКА появился параметр Т ОТВЕТА:выставить можно от 100 до 450 мсек-Это время ожидания ответа от ЭБУ. При работе с блоками с которыми рвётся связь можно попробовать увеличить время ожидания отвнта(раньше было стабильно 150 мсек.И ПОДСВЕТКА и Т ОТВЕТА выставляется кнопкой ВВЕРХ по кругу.кнопкой ВНИЗ производится ВЫБОР подсветки или времени.Эта программа для контроллера без 24с64.Проверим её,потом возьмусь за другую. Исходники.zip
  14. Для чтения пропусков зажигания надо подавать другой запрос ЭБУ.Насчёт ошибок-не знаю что выдают бош и январи.Те ошибки (по бош и январям) считываются вместе с диагностическими параметрами.Конечно если их убрать,то освободится часть памяти.В таком случае можно прописать в проге время между посылками запроса к ЭБУ и сохранять его в EEPROM.Может более древние блоки просто не успевают всё переварить.
  15. Всё понял,после выходных буду разбираться.Про неустойчивую связь:не вижу разницы между обращением к М73 или М74 и к Январям.Может дело не в программе,а в ЭБУ?
  16. Всем привет.В схеме R13,R14 и R15 в принципе не нужны.Прошивка ,которую последний раз выкладывал , подходит к обеим версиям( с 24с64 и без неё).У кого нет в схеме 24с64 просто не будет текстовой расшифровки ошибок ЭБУ.
  17. Схемы ещё нет.Жду "Энтузиастов"В протеусе всё понятно!По регулировке яркости: регулируется- 0% 50% 60% и т.д по кругу.Установка кнопкой вверх ,сохранение в EEPROM кнопкой ввод.
  18. Поправил управление РХХ и оборотами.С неверными показаниями для М74 буду разбираться.В меню ИСПОЛНИТЕЛЬНЫЕ МЕХАНИЗМЫ дабавлена регулировка яркости LCD ШИМ . Изменения в схеме: На PORTD.7 теперь сидит УПРАВЛЕНИЕ ПОДСВЕТКОЙ,ВЫХОД ЗВУКА ПЕРЕНЕСЁН НА PORTD.2!!!!!!!!!! Для управления подсветкой я использовал полевой транзистор с изолированным затвором индуцированным каналом N-типа(какой то IRF с материнской платы),но думаю ,что можно использовать и биполярный NPN соответствующей мощности.Посмотреть подключение можно в протеусе.Прогу в контроллер уминал ногами.Осталось свободно 84 Байта из 32 КБАЙТ.На этом модернизацию считаю законченной. Жду замечаний. Исходники.zip
  19. Новая версия прошивки и исходники.Дописаны дополнительные параметры Я7.2(счётчики пропусков и т.д. , исправлены пропуски(очерёдность) по М73,вместо контрольной лампы-включение вентилятора 2.Замечания учту. Исходники.zip
  20. Привет всем.По пропускам:значит в документации указан порядок работы цилиндров.Поправлю.Катушки на рабочем движке отключить нельзя(насколько я знаю).С оборотами сложней.У меня тоже на М73 работает не так:выставляешь.нажимаешь ввод,а они прибавляются,но меньше чем выставлено задание,но с каждым нажатьем ввода стараются приблизиться к заданию.Проверь ещё РХХ.Да для задания оборотов надо их выставить .А потом нажать ВВОД.Проверь ещё раз.
  21. Обращение ко всем кому интересна эта тема!Давайте определяться что мы будем делать? Есть 2 варианта: 1)использовать мегу 32 и 24с64 2)использовать мегу 644 без 24с64 Я скоро запутаюсь в программах со всеми вытекающими отсюда последствиями)))Писать сразу 2 проги нет смысла)))Жду ваших предложений)))
  22. А в чём дело было если не секрет?
  23. Думаю что хватит.У меня просьба!Проверь пожалуйста соответствует ли нумерация цилиндров выводу( например пролусков зажигания) и на каком ЭБУ как.Пока кроме ЯНВАРЕЙ(там ещё делаю).
  24. Какой прогой смотреть компорт не знаю.Причин для выдачи МК неверного кода не знаю.Чему я его научил,то он и делает.Проследи проходит ли после вывода заставки такая последовательность на выходе передатчика:25 мсек низкий уровень,25 мсек высокий и сразу пакет.
  25. Думаю дня через 2 или 3 будет(всё зависит от загруженности на работе-дома не пишу).Там ещё оказывается есть для Я7.2 дополнительные параметры(где счётчики пропусков и т.д.).Я про них и не знал.Большое спасибо ViViseKtor за любезно предоставленную информацию.Да кстати я тебя нечаянно обману ,когда сказал, что Мега644 имеет память 32 КБ.Там 64 КБ,в книге наверное опечатка(сведения брал из книги).
×
×
  • Создать...
Яндекс цитирования